This PR improves the UX and accessibility of the V2CouponCenter page.

💡 What:

  • Integrated Util.showToast to provide visual feedback when a user copies a coupon code.
  • Replaced the manual preloader with the reusable CustomPreloader component.
  • Added aria-label="Volver" to the header back button.
  • Added aria-hidden="true" to all decorative Material Icons.
  • Updated button classes from v2-btn-primary (undefined) to v2-btn-filled.

🎯 Why:

  • Users need immediate feedback after interacting with "Copy to clipboard" actions.
  • Standardizing components improves maintainability and visual consistency.
  • Proper ARIA attributes ensure the interface is usable by screen reader users.

♿ Accessibility:

  • Back button now has a descriptive label.
  • Decorative icons are hidden from screen readers to reduce noise.
  • Loading state uses semantic role="progressbar".

This PR also addresses pre-existing linter errors in V2CaseStudy.jsx (unused import) and V2FlashcardStudy.jsx (unused variable) to ensure a clean build.
